邵阳市网站建设_网站建设公司_Angular_seo优化
2026/1/13 8:34:17 网站建设 项目流程

AI人脸隐私卫士在智能相册中的集成应用案例

1. 引言:智能相册时代的人脸隐私挑战

随着智能手机和云存储的普及,个人数字影像数据呈爆炸式增长。智能相册系统通过AI技术实现了自动分类、人脸识别与场景识别,极大提升了用户体验。然而,随之而来的人脸隐私泄露风险也日益凸显——一张合照可能包含多位亲友的面部信息,一旦上传至公共平台或被第三方应用调用,极易造成不可逆的隐私暴露。

传统手动打码方式效率低下,难以应对海量照片处理需求;而依赖云端服务的自动化方案又存在数据外传的安全隐患。为此,我们推出「AI人脸隐私卫士」——一款基于MediaPipe的本地化、高灵敏度、全自动人脸打码工具,专为智能相册场景设计,兼顾隐私保护强度用户体验流畅性

本案例将深入解析该技术在智能相册系统中的集成路径,展示如何实现“零数据外泄、毫秒级响应、精准全覆盖”的隐私脱敏能力。

2. 技术架构与核心机制

2.1 系统整体架构设计

AI人脸隐私卫士采用轻量级前后端分离架构,运行于用户本地设备(如NAS、边缘计算盒子或PC),确保所有图像数据不经过网络传输:

[用户上传图片] ↓ [WebUI前端 → Flask后端] ↓ [MediaPipe Face Detection模型推理] ↓ [动态高斯模糊 + 安全框绘制] ↓ [返回脱敏图像]
  • 前端:提供简洁直观的Web界面,支持拖拽上传、批量处理预览。
  • 后端:使用Python Flask构建RESTful API,负责图像接收、调用模型、返回结果。
  • 核心引擎:集成Google MediaPipe的Face Detection模块,启用Full Range模式以覆盖远距离小脸检测。

2.2 核心技术选型依据

技术组件选择理由
MediaPipe Face Detection轻量高效,CPU即可运行,支持6MP输入分辨率,适合离线部署
BlazeFace 架构专为移动端优化,推理速度达毫秒级,满足实时处理需求
OpenCV 图像处理提供成熟的高斯模糊、矩形绘制功能,性能稳定可靠
Flask + WebUI易于集成,跨平台兼容性强,适合非专业用户操作

相比YOLO系列或RetinaFace等重型模型,MediaPipe在精度与性能之间取得了更优平衡,尤其适用于资源受限但对延迟敏感的终端场景。

3. 关键功能实现详解

3.1 高灵敏度人脸检测策略

为应对多人合照中“远处小脸”、“侧脸遮挡”等问题,系统启用了MediaPipe的Full Range Detection Mode,并调整关键参数提升召回率:

import cv2 import mediapipe as mp mp_face_detection = mp.solutions.face_detection face_detector = mp_face_detection.FaceDetection( model_selection=1, # 0: short-range, 1: full-range (up to 2m+) min_detection_confidence=0.3 # 降低阈值,提高小脸检出率 )

💡 参数说明: -model_selection=1:启用长焦模式,可检测画面边缘及远景中仅占几十像素的小脸。 -min_detection_confidence=0.3:牺牲少量误检率换取更高召回率,符合“宁可错杀”的隐私优先原则。

实际测试表明,在一张1920×1080合影中,系统能成功识别出最远距离约5米、面部尺寸不足40px的个体,检出率达92%以上。

3.2 动态打码算法设计

静态马赛克容易破坏画面美感,且对大脸过度模糊、小脸模糊不足。为此,我们设计了自适应模糊半径算法

def apply_dynamic_blur(image, bbox): x_min, y_min, w, h = bbox face_size = max(w, h) # 取宽高中较大者作为尺度基准 # 根据人脸大小动态计算核大小(必须为奇数) kernel_base = int(face_size * 0.3) kernel_size = max(9, kernel_base if kernel_base % 2 == 1 else kernel_base + 1) # 提取人脸区域并应用高斯模糊 roi = image[y_min:y_min+h, x_min:x_min+w] blurred_roi = cv2.GaussianBlur(roi, (kernel_size, kernel_size), 0) image[y_min:y_min+h, x_min:x_min+w] = blurred_roi # 绘制绿色安全框提示已保护 cv2.rectangle(image, (x_min, y_min), (x_min+w, y_min+h), (0, 255, 0), 2) return image

📌 实现要点: - 模糊核大小与人脸尺寸成正比,避免“大脸糊不清、小脸看不清”的问题。 - 使用GaussianBlur而非均值模糊,保留一定纹理感,视觉更自然。 - 添加绿色边框作为反馈标识,增强用户信任感。

3.3 离线安全机制保障

整个系统运行在本地环境中,具备以下安全特性:

  • 无网络外联:镜像默认关闭公网访问权限,仅开放内网HTTP服务。
  • 内存不留痕:图像处理完成后立即释放内存对象,不生成临时文件。
  • 可审计日志:记录操作时间戳与处理数量,便于追溯但不保存原始内容。

这一设计从根本上杜绝了因云端上传导致的数据泄露风险,特别适合家庭私有云、企业内部系统等高安全要求场景。

4. 在智能相册中的集成实践

4.1 集成场景与流程

AI人脸隐私卫士可作为智能相册系统的前置过滤模块,部署在照片入库前的“隐私清洗”环节:

graph LR A[新照片导入] --> B{是否含人脸?} B -- 否 --> C[直接归档] B -- 是 --> D[调用AI隐私卫士打码] D --> E[生成脱敏副本] E --> F[原图加密存档 / 脱敏图展示]

典型应用场景包括: - 家庭共享相册:父母上传孩子活动照时自动隐藏其他小朋友面部。 - 企业团建管理:HR发布集体活动照前批量脱敏员工面部。 - 医疗影像归档:去除患者面部信息后再用于教学或分析。

4.2 性能实测数据

我们在一台搭载Intel i5-10代处理器、16GB内存的普通PC上进行压力测试:

图像类型分辨率平均处理耗时检出人数是否漏检
单人近景1920×108048ms1
多人合照4032×3024112ms7无漏检
远距抓拍3840×216098ms5(最小脸≈35px)1人轻微侧脸漏检
批量处理(100张)平均1080P1.3s/张-全部完成

✅ 结论:即使在无GPU环境下,也能实现接近实时的处理速度,满足日常使用需求。

5. 总结

5. 总结

AI人脸隐私卫士通过深度整合MediaPipe高灵敏度模型与本地化部署架构,在智能相册场景中实现了高效、安全、美观的自动化隐私保护闭环。其核心价值体现在三个方面:

  1. 技术精准性:采用Full Range模式+低置信度阈值策略,显著提升远距离、小尺寸人脸的检出能力,有效覆盖多人合照复杂场景。
  2. 工程实用性:基于BlazeFace的轻量架构可在纯CPU环境毫秒级完成处理,无需昂贵硬件投入,易于集成进现有系统。
  3. 隐私安全性:全程本地离线运行,杜绝数据上传风险,真正实现“我的照片我做主”。

未来,我们将进一步探索以下方向: - 支持选择性打码:允许用户标记“可信人物”免于打码; - 增加语音描述脱敏:结合ASR技术,清除元数据中的姓名提及; - 接入区块链存证:为每张脱敏图生成哈希指纹,确保处理过程可验证。

隐私不是功能的负担,而是智能系统的底线。AI人脸隐私卫士不仅是一款工具,更是推动AI向善的技术实践样本。


💡获取更多AI镜像

想探索更多AI镜像和应用场景?访问 CSDN星图镜像广场,提供丰富的预置镜像,覆盖大模型推理、图像生成、视频生成、模型微调等多个领域,支持一键部署。

需要专业的网站建设服务?

联系我们获取免费的网站建设咨询和方案报价,让我们帮助您实现业务目标

立即咨询